# Handover: ProctorPath Queue

Welcome to the team. The exam-proctoring queue at Veldtware handles session check-ins and flag reviews; it's sensitive to backlog during morning exam windows, so watch the depth gauge closely. Marta's runbook covers the retry logic in detail. Before taking over on-call, confirm your local copy matches the live settings, which are recorded below.

config for kagag-kaweg:
QUENIX_HOST=quenix.qorvelsys.internal
QUENIX_PORT=5432

Subject: Key rotation for FareForge rules engine

Hi plugin authors,

Quick heads-up: we're rotating the FareForge internal rates-service key this Friday. The old one stops working at cutover, so update your plugin configs before then or your shipping-fee lookups will start bouncing. Everything else stays the same — same endpoints, same headers. The new key to drop into your config is below.

gateway credential: kto3_qfe

Meeting notes (excerpt) — Warehouse shift briefing, Orvell Storage. Item 2: master keys. The full set for buildings C and D goes to the Finmore locksmith for re-cutting on Tuesday. Keys stay in the tagged pouch, logged out by the shift lead only. At courier collection, follow the instruction below.

dispatch memo: the quenvan holax courier leaves the zoreth briath kasvan ledger at gate 7481 under passcode 618862

Ticket: SQL lint misconfig on Quartzline staging. The sqlfluff ruleset for the Brambleworth warehouse repo is pointing at the prod dialect config, so every staging CI run flags valid statements. Support: tell affected users to pull the updated env file before re-running lint. The file also wires the lint bot's connection to the metadata store. The next line in the env file sets that credential.

secret setting of yafof-tawep: RELAY_SECRET8=8abb5772